Description:

A simple chess clock for the mobile phone written in Java.

Features:

  • Two count down timers
  • Configurable game length*
  • Optional time increment per move* (Fischer time control)
  • Optional sound
  • Trivial user interface
  • Big clumsy numbers so that grandpa can also play
  • Optional upside down display of black's clock

Tested on several Nokia, Motorola models and BlackBerry, but runs on every Java capable device that has MIDP 2.0 or higher and CLCD 1.0 or higher, which means practically all mobile phones nowadays.

*This is a demo version that does not allow setting the time limits. You can download the full version here.
